            Most little babies are taught how to use a litter box by their moms.
            It's instict to want to scratch in loose material. Just make sure you offer a smaller place when they are tiny, and then upgrade to the largest box you can find when they are larger. They like to have room to move around.

            Definately go with one from a shelter, as these are the ones in most need of a home.
            Expect to have to jump through some hoops to bring a kitty home. Line up references they can call to verify you'll be a good pet owner before you head out. Most shelters are very selective about who they let take an animal, because they don't want it back in 3 months. ;)

            Don't leave the cat and the baby alone. They should be fine together, but accidents do happen (babies like to pull and bite tails). Never let it sleep in the crib or on/near the baby. Good luck!

                                                                                        I don't want to read this whole thread, I read some of it so if I repeat somebody sorry about that. Cats do best when trained with squirt bottles when kittens. Make sure they don't see you directly spray them, if they scratch on a couch or get on the table do this, while your not at home, leave the squirt bottle on the table or in a problem area, they will leave it alone. I trained my cats like this and for the most part they are good, no table jumping, no couch scratching and so on. Usually saying no when kittens works too but sometimes they don't listen.

                                                                                        Get a kitten or a cat from a shelter, thats the best way to go, I prefer male cats, they are more cuddly and have less of an attitude, but you must get them neutered. Litter box training is simple, they usually go right to it.

                                                                                        Good luck! I am glad that most people haven't experienced problems with newborns, I am always afriad when I have kids I will have to get rid of the cats
